Output aa8580fd8417d9c0ea9933de5f4ebbbd71ee94de8ab7edea5e5bc026cb76453b:0

value
596139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1de9a0ded90ae51ef182e71054c314a0a83edaa3 OP_EQUAL
address
34RBPtjDDi4rGLdXosB4BctwNBodutqmbU
transaction
aa8580fd8417d9c0ea9933de5f4ebbbd71ee94de8ab7edea5e5bc026cb76453b
spent
true